The Basics of Rubber Bushings
Before we explore their influence on steering, let’s first understand what rubber bushings are. A rubber bushing is a cylindrical component that consists of an inner metal sleeve, an outer metal sleeve, and a rubber layer in between. The rubber layer is the key element, as it provides flexibility and absorbs vibrations and shocks.
The primary functions of rubber bushings are many. They act as a buffer between different parts of the steering system, reducing noise, vibration, and harshness (NVH). By isolating the components from each other, they protect the steering system from premature wear and damage. Additionally, rubber bushings help to maintain proper alignment and ensure smooth movement of the steering components.
Influence on Steering Precision
One of the most notable impacts of rubber bushings on steering is their effect on steering precision. In a well – functioning steering system, every input from the driver should translate accurately into the movement of the wheels. Rubber bushings contribute to this by providing a controlled amount of flexibility.
Imagine a situation where the steering linkage is too rigid. Minor road imperfections or misalignments could cause abrupt and unpredictable movements in the steering wheel. Rubber bushings absorb these shocks and vibrations, allowing the steering system to adjust gradually. This controlled flexibility means that the steering response is more accurate and predictable. For example, when taking a turn, the steering wheel moves smoothly, and the vehicle follows the intended path precisely.
On the other hand, if the rubber in the bushing is worn out or damaged, the steering precision can be severely affected. A worn bushing may allow excessive play in the steering components, leading to a loose or wandering steering feel. The driver may find it difficult to keep the vehicle on a straight path, and the steering response becomes less immediate.
Impact on Steering Comfort
Steering comfort is another area where rubber bushings make a significant difference. Driving is meant to be an enjoyable experience, and a comfortable steering system is essential for that. Rubber bushings play a pivotal role in reducing the transmission of vibrations and shocks from the road to the steering wheel.
When a vehicle encounters bumps, potholes, or uneven road surfaces, the rubber bushings absorb the impact energy. This energy absorption keeps the steering wheel stable and minimizes the jarring sensations felt by the driver. For instance, on a rough country road, the driver can still hold the steering wheel with ease, without being constantly jolted by every imperfection on the road.
In contrast, without proper rubber bushings, the steering wheel would transmit all the vibrations directly to the driver’s hands. This not only makes the driving experience uncomfortable but can also lead to fatigue over long distances. A fatigued driver is more likely to make mistakes, which poses a safety risk.
Contribution to Steering Stability
Steering stability is crucial for safe driving, especially at high speeds. Rubber bushings help to maintain the stability of the steering system by providing proper support and control to the steering components.
In a vehicle’s steering system, there are various linkages and joints that need to work together smoothly. Rubber bushings ensure that these components maintain their correct positions and move in a coordinated manner. When a vehicle is traveling at high speed, sudden maneuvers or gusts of wind can cause the wheels to lose alignment slightly. The rubber bushings in the steering system help to counteract these forces and keep the vehicle stable.
If the rubber bushings are damaged or not functioning correctly, the steering stability can be compromised. The vehicle may become more prone to swaying or drifting, and the driver may have to make constant corrections to keep it on track. This lack of stability is not only a nuisance but can also be extremely dangerous, especially in emergency situations.
Long – Term Performance and Durability
Rubber bushings also have a long – term impact on the performance and durability of the steering system. As mentioned earlier, they act as a protective barrier between components, reducing wear and tear.
In a steering system without proper bushings, the metal – to – metal contact between components would cause rapid deterioration. The constant friction and rubbing would lead to premature failure of the parts, resulting in costly repairs and replacements. By absorbing shocks and vibrations, rubber bushings extend the lifespan of the steering system as a whole.
For example, in heavy – duty vehicles that are subject to more severe conditions, high – quality rubber bushings are essential. These vehicles often carry heavy loads and operate on rough roads, which put a lot of stress on the steering system. Well – designed rubber bushings can withstand this stress and ensure that the steering system remains reliable over a long period.
Selection and Maintenance of Rubber Bushings
As a rubber bushing supplier, I understand the importance of selecting the right bushings for different applications. The type, size, and hardness of the rubber bushing can vary depending on the specific requirements of the steering system.
When it comes to vehicle manufacturers, they need to consider factors such as the vehicle’s weight, power, and intended use. For high – performance sports cars, for example, stiffer rubber bushings may be required to provide more precise steering and better handling. On the other hand, for passenger cars focused on comfort, softer bushings may be the better choice.
Maintenance is also key to ensuring the continued performance of rubber bushings. Regular inspections can help detect signs of wear and damage early. This allows for timely replacement of the bushings, preventing potential problems with the steering system.
